János vitéz is an epic poem written in Hungarian by Sándor Petőfi. It was written in 1844, and is notable for its length, 370 quatrains divided into 27 chapters, and for its wordplay. It is a story of the young shepherd who is forced to leave his home and undergoes adventures as he defeats the villains such as Turks and witches while searching for his true love.
